Top Locations Tagged with Peachtree hotel group
Peachtree hotel group in United states - 30326/ near fulton
Peachtree hotel group in United states - 30342/ near fulton
Peachtree hotel group in United states - 30326/ near fulton
Peachtree hotel group in United states - 70433/ near covington